Famously scenic, the Hankyu commuter train trundles daily through changing
landscape unaware of the heartaches of the passengers it carries.
On the outward journey we are introduced to the emotional dilemmas of five
characters as we puzzle out how they will unravel; on the return journey six
months later, we watch them resolve:
- a man meets the woman who always happens to borrow a library book just before
he can take it out himself
- a woman in a white bridal dress boards looking inexplicably sad
- a university student leaves his hometown for the first time
- a girl prepares to leave her abusive boyfriend;
- a widow discusses adopting the Dachshund she has always wanted with her
granddaughter.
As the season and the landscapes change, passengers jostle and connect, holding
and releasing their dreams and ...
